Setting Using Internet Explorer
Encoding Page
This page is for setting JPEG and MPEG4 encoding parameters.
This page can be used during access using AadminB or AoperatorB.
Press the [OK] button to enable the new settings.
If the [OK] button is pressed upon entering an invalid value, a warning message will appear and the
entry will be denied. Press the [Cancel] button to restore the invalid entry to the current value.
When settings on this page are altered during playback using the built-in viewer, reboot the viewer.
There is a maximum limit to the bit rate for transmission by VN-V25U/26U. If a bit rate that exceeds
the maximum limit is specified, this new setting will not be applied. For details on the maximum
transmission limit, refer to the section on ANetwork RequirementsB (A Page 24).

A Frame Size For setting the frame size of each JPEG or MPEG4 screen to VGA (640 x
480) or QVGA (320 x 240).
Select one of the four different patterns.
When the frame size of JPEG is the same as MPEG4, the privacy mask can
be displayed on both images. When the frame size of JPEG is different from
MPEG4, privacy mask can only be displayed on QVGA images. (A Page
56)
